What is Unified Balance?

Decaf now treats your USDC balance as one single balance, regardless of whether it's on Solana or Stellar. You no longer need to manually swap between chains before using a feature (Card, Send, Invest & MoneyGram coming soon) — we handle the conversion automatically behind the scenes.


How It Works Across Features
​1. Card (Rain) 💳

When you fund your Rain Card, Decaf pulls from your total USDC balance. If your funds are on Stellar but the card needs Solana, the swap happens automatically. You just tap "Add Funds" and go.

2. Send 💸

Decaf will automatically use your available USDC from either chain.

​Before: User needed USDC on the specific chain according to the destination.
Now: Just send, Decaf routes the funds to the right destination chain (Stellar or Solana).


3. Invest (Lulo) 📈

When swapping tokens through the Exchange feature, Decaf considers your full balance across both chains. No need to pre-position funds on the right network.


FAQ

1. Do I need to do anything different?

No. It's automatic.

2. Will I see two separate balances?

You'll see your total combined USDC balance but you can click on the arrow to see the specific balance on each chain.

3. Are there extra fees for the auto-swap?
The cross-chain swap is handled internally by Decaf at no extra cost to the user.

4. Does this work for all tokens?
This applies specifically to USDC across Solana and Stellar.
